The hexadecimal value (hex value) of this color is #bbccec. In RGB, it consists of 73.3% Red, 80.0% Green, and 92.5% Blue. Likewise, in the CMYK color space, it consists of 20.8% Cyan, 13.6% Magenta, 0% Yellow, and 7.5% Black. On the color wheel, its Hue is found at 219.2°, with saturation of 56.3% and lightness of 82.9%. The decimal value for #bbccec is 12307692, and its nearest "web safe" color is #ccccff. In the RGB color space, the strongest component for #bbccec is blue. In the CMYK color space, its strongest component is cyan. And in the RYB color space, its strongest component is blue.

Analogous Colors of #bbccec

Analogous colors are located 30 degrees away from a color's hue on the color wheel. For #bbccec — which has hue 219.2° — its analogous colors are located at 189.2° and 249.2° on the color wheel, with the same saturation and lightness as #bbccec.

Triadic Colors of #bbccec

Triadic colors are located 120 degrees away from a color's hue on the color wheel, which means the original color and its triadic colors are equidistant from one another on the color wheel and form a triangle. For #bbccec — which has hue 219.2° — its triadic colors are located at 99.2° and 339.2° on the color wheel, with the same saturation and lightness as #bbccec.

Complementary Color of #bbccec

A complementary color is located opposite a color on the color wheel (180 degrees away). For #bbccec — which has hue 219.2° — its complementary color is located at 39.2° on the color wheel, with the same saturation and lightness as #bbccec.

Split Complementary Colors of #bbccec

Split complementary colors are the analogs of a color's complement, which places them 210 degrees away on the color wheel from an original color. For #bbccec — which has hue 219.2° — its split complementary colors its split complementary colors are located at 9.2° and 219.2° on the color wheel, with the same saturation and lightness as #bbccec.

Tetradic Colors of #bbccec

Tetradic colors are two sets of complementary colors on either side of a color wheel from each other, forming a rectangle on the color wheel. For #bbccec — which has hue 219.2° — its tetradic colors are located at 129.2°, 219.2°, 309.2°, and 39.2° on the color wheel, with the same saturation and lightness as #bbccec.

Monochromatic Colors of #bbccec

Monochromatic colors are colors that share a common hue but that have different saturations and lightness. For #bbccec, we show 9 different monochromatic colors of it, ranging from #a7b7d4 — (which has very low saturation and very low lightness) — to #d8e4fa (which has a very high saturation and very high lightness).

Accessibility

Not Accessibility Recommended

We analyzed whether #bbccec is an accessible color when used as a text / foreground color against a white background. This analysis is based on the Web Content Accessibility Guidelines (WCAG) 2 Level issued by W3C. Based on this analysis, we calculate a contrast ratio against white of approximately 1.6:1 against white. Under both the AA and AAA level standards, this is not a high enough ratio to be considered accessible for either normal size or large text.
